Hey Guys and Gals

I thought that it would be cool to see what remedies other bonsai growers use.

I'm an Organic guy myself and tend to stay away from Chemicals due to a few F-ups I made while using them.

So yeah, please post your remedies......

Here is what I use for problems currently:

White Fly, spider mites and plant lice - Clove or Citronella Oil.

I got some oil from a buddy and he said it helped him. So I applied it and my white fly and mite problems were history. I spray twice a week for precaution and the smell of clove/citronella smells much better than chemicals.

Garlic based concoctions also help.

Ground cinnamon is a great antifungal for bonsai trees.
So is diluted peroxide...although it's not really organic. I used it a few years ago to save my pine.

YOu can just dust cinnamon on the tree, the peroxide you need to REALLY dilute. If not it'll kill the tree. I use a cap full of peroxide in an old clean windex bottle and spray it on a few times a day.
